Historically, has there ever been a civilian vs military mid air collision in a MOA? If so how likely is this to happen?

The nearest MOA (Gamecock) is almost 20 NM from the crash site. We know the C-150 departed KMKS and was headed to Myrtle Beach. Worst case, assuming a direct flight path, it would've been 30 miles was even in a position to enter the MOA via the southern border. That airspace is active 10k-17.9k. Those altitudes don't make much sense for a short hop to MYR or CRE and aren't very 100hp C-150 friendly on a hot summer day in SC either.

It seems unlikely to be a factor in this crash. I'm not sure how this spawned into an airspace debate, but if people want to talk about airspace, it seems like a great time for both sides to learn from each other.

ATC cannot route IFR traffic through an active MOA. They either have to send them around, or call the airspace back

Contradictory statement - they CAN route IFR traffic through an active MOA...by calling airspace back. It's semantics, in the end they're putting an IFR aircraft through the MOA. That said, I don't care because everyone knows what's going on and it's generally safe.
